    Think about this, they have the second pick, and they already have Drew Brees so they wouldn't need VInce Young or Matt Leinart. I could see them going with D'Brickshaw Ferguson, to fortify their offensive line now that they have Drew Brees. I could also see them going defense with Mario Williams or AJ Hawks because their defense was one of the last ranking defenses last season. Who do you think they will go with? [​IMG]
